Physician Leadership: The Key to Burnout Reduction in Your Medical Organization

The term “burnout” in medicine may be defined as chronic, long-term, unresolvable job stress that leads to overwhelming exhaustion, and a lack of fulfillment. Job stressors such as administrative work, long hours, and, most importantly, loss of empowerment all work to reinforce feelings of futility.
